WMSsystemer are software applications that manage and optimize warehouse operations. A WMS coordinates the movement and storage of goods within a warehouse and links activities to other business systems to improve accuracy and speed from receipt to shipment. The primary goals are to provide real-time inventory visibility, reduce handling costs, and enable scalable fulfillment.
